Today, I notice that we continue to be fascinated with the way children see things and the associations that they make. Even their "mistakes" are attractive because they come from a very pure place. Yet, at a certain age, the promotion of the creative impulse stops. Once a child begins going to school, societal pressures start to take hold; acting a little "different" becomes a problem, and children are pressured to conform. When I was six years old, I was hit on the left hand with a ruler for trying to write with it. Now, though it happens in more subtle ways, society still discourages children's impulses to think, write, draw, sing, or behave in ways that . Hyperactivity is punished or, worse yet, medicated. It is no surprise that we grow up afraid to differ, and afraid to express our true selves.

The purpose of research in science is to bring a higher level of confidence and certainty to our understanding than is possible by belief, faith, or reason alone. Science therefore requires a highly critical attitude. The scientist must be a skeptic who has to be shown, a doubter who must be convinced, a cynic who believes that people may wittingly or unwittingly deceive or misunderstand one another. Research must be designed so that it is tight and its conclusions compelling. Conversely, if an investigation is flawed such that the results are open to plausible alternative interpretations, the findings . It is the researcher's responsibility to eliminate or rule out all plausible alternative explanations and to recognize and point out when others have failed to be entirely convincing ,rather than generously to overlook logical weaknesses because "they probably don't matter".

When was the last time you were bewildered? The very fact that bewilderment is such a rare condition for most of us, despite the complexity of our lives, is a clear indication that the theory of the world in our heads is at least as complex as the world we perceive around us. The reason we are usually not aware of the theory is simply that it . Just as a fish takes water for granted until deprived of it, so we become aware of our dependence on a theory to make sense of the world only when the theory proves inadequate, when the world fails to make sense. When were you last bewildered by something that you heard or read? Our theory of the world seems ready to make sense of almost everything we are likely to experience in spoken and written language.
